Ferric chloride

The production of ferric chloride is characterized by the following features:

  • Feedstock variety:
    • From ferric oxide etching with HCl
    • From mixed oxides, with chlorination section
    • From iron scraps
    • From exhausted pickling solutions
  • Commercial concentration 40%
  • Purity according to EN 888:2005 (potable water)
  • Safe design preventing from critical situations
    • No hydrogen development
  • Low energy consumption of concentration section
  • Automated process with reduced workload demand
  • Modular capacity, from 10.000 tons/y
